How much time do you have if you do the drive?

Belfast has a lot of things of moderate interest — it’s not a quaint small Irish town and it’s not a European capital city. The Titanic museum or black cab tours are the most typical tourist activities and my personal favorite is pints in a snug at the Crown Liquor Saloon. The castle isn’t worth stopping inside for but you can drive by it.

The loop from Belfast back to Belfast or over to Derry is a much bigger draw.

In a rush you can drive straight up to Ballycastle and hit the Causeway, Carrick-Rede, and Bushmills
If you have a full day or two I start with Carrockfergus, drive all of the Antrim coast and its glens, drive Torr head before getting into the big stuff. After Porststewart/Portrush you’ll head to Coleraine and from there it depends on time. If you have another day you can head to Derry and see the walls and a bit of Inishowen peninsula. If you don’t have the time you head back to belfast or Dublin from coleraine and if possible stop at the Dark Hedges on the way.
